Corrigendum to ABCB5+ mesenchymal stromal cells facilitate complete and durable wound closure in recessive dystrophic epidermolysis bullosa [Cytotherapy 25 (2023) 782–788/1562, (S1465324923000361), (10.1016/j.jcyt.2023.01.015)]

Kathrin Dieter, Elke Niebergall-Roth, Cristina Daniele, Silvia Fluhr, Natasha Y. Frank, Christoph Ganss, Dimitra Kiritsi, John A. McGrath, Jakub Tolar, Markus H. Frank, Mark A. Kluth

Research output: Contribution to journalComment/debatepeer-review

Abstract

The authors regret that the following funding information was missed: Contributions by JT to this work were supported by National Institutes of Health (NIH), National Institute of Arthritis and Musculoskeletal and Skin Diseases (NIAMS) grant #R01AR063070. The authors would like to apologize for any inconvenience caused.
